Step 1
Place the split peas in a bowl and pour tap water. Wait 2-3 minutes and use a colander to rinse them with plenty of water. Repeat until the water is crystal clear (2-3 more times). Drain and transfer to a pot.
Step 2
In a pot over high heat, add 4 cups out of 6 (800ml out of 1.200ml) of water or vegetable broth, shredded carrot, sliced onion, oil olive, and bay leaves. Bring to a boil for 5 minutes. Turn the heat down to medium and simmer. Remove with a spoon the white foam that usually surfaces. It takes more or less half an hour for the initial amount of liquid to be absorbed. Add salt, pepper and cumin.
Step 3
Add gradually more HOT water or broth, turn down the heat to low and stir frequently until split peas are very tender and the texture is similar to a thick soup. At that point, stir quite often. It takes more or less 50 minutes but cooking time depends on the product.
Step 4
Remove from heat and add lemon. Put the mixture in a food processor or a hand blender and mix until the peas are smooth and creamy, like a puree. Add more hot water if it is too thick.
Step 5
Serve with extra virgin olive oil, diced onion, thyme, freshly ground pepper.
